Rivers

A river is a substantial natural watercourse that flows through a defined channel toward another river, lake, wetland, sea, or inland basin. Its system may include tributaries, distributaries, floodplains, seasonal reaches, gorges, waterfalls, and deltas far beyond any single mapped park relationship. The distinction from a stream depends on local convention, scale, and source usage rather than one universal rule.

Ridges

A ridge is an elongated crest or connected line of high ground that separates slopes, valleys, drainage basins, or neighboring terrain. Ridges can result from erosion, folding, faulting, volcanic construction, glacial shaping, or resistant rock layers and may contain multiple summits or saddles. The type describes the linear landform rather than an extended mountain range or an individual peak.

Valleys

A valley is an elongated area of lower ground between hills, mountains, ridges, or plateaus, commonly organized around a river, stream, glacier, or former drainage path. Valleys may be carved by flowing water or ice, controlled by faults and folds, or shaped by combinations of erosion and deposition. The type is broader than a narrow gorge and describes the containing landform rather than only the watercourse or settlement within it.
